2007-01-11 |
Devang Patel | Start using PMStack. Now each pass is responsibe for... |
tree | commitdiff |
2007-01-11 |
Devang Patel | Use getPassManagerType() instead of dynamic_cast. |
tree | commitdiff |
2007-01-11 |
Reid Spencer | Rename BoolTy as Int1Ty. Patch by Sheng Zhou. |
tree | commitdiff |
2007-01-11 |
Zhou Sheng | Remove unnecessary boolean type check. |
tree | commitdiff |
2007-01-11 |
Zhou Sheng | For PR1043: |
tree | commitdiff |
2007-01-11 |
Zhou Sheng | Fixed indentation. |
tree | commitdiff |
2007-01-11 |
Reid Spencer | Shut up a warning about signed/unsigned. |
tree | commitdiff |
2007-01-11 |
Chris Lattner | simplify some logic further |
tree | commitdiff |
2007-01-11 |
Chris Lattner | Recommit my previous patch with a bugfix: printInfoComm... |
tree | commitdiff |
2007-01-11 |
Nick Lewycky | Quiet compiler warning. The only reason the function... |
tree | commitdiff |
2007-01-11 |
Nick Lewycky | New predicate simplifier! |
tree | commitdiff |
2007-01-11 |
Devang Patel | Add PassManagerType enum. |
tree | commitdiff |
2007-01-11 |
Reid Spencer | Avoid taking the address of a macro by checking to... |
tree | commitdiff |
2007-01-11 |
Reid Spencer | Implement better constant folding of unordered FCMP... |
tree | commitdiff |
2007-01-11 |
Devang Patel | Robustify assingPassManager() for Module, Function... |
tree | commitdiff |
2007-01-10 |
Reid Spencer | Allow LLI, in interpreter mode, to find stdin, stdout... |
tree | commitdiff |
2007-01-10 |
Reid Spencer | Back out the last patch which is a nightly test killer... |
tree | commitdiff |
2007-01-10 |
Chris Lattner | Last refactoring before PR645: split up getSlot into... |
tree | commitdiff |
2007-01-10 |
Chris Lattner | eliminate some iterator gymnastics. |
tree | commitdiff |
2007-01-10 |
Reid Spencer | Change the file header name as this file was renamed. |
tree | commitdiff |
2007-01-10 |
Reid Spencer | Rename Writer.cpp as CBackend.cpp so it doesn't conflic... |
tree | commitdiff |
2007-01-09 |
Chris Lattner | Fix a bug in heap-sra that caused compilation failure... |
tree | commitdiff |
2007-01-09 |
Reid Spencer | For PR1099: |
tree | commitdiff |
2007-01-09 |
Chris Lattner | Inline insertValue into CreateModuleSlot/CreateFunctionSlot |
tree | commitdiff |
2007-01-09 |
Chris Lattner | Remove a bunch of complex logic that is completely... |
tree | commitdiff |
2007-01-09 |
Chris Lattner | Split CreateSlot into two versions, one for globals... |
tree | commitdiff |
2007-01-09 |
Chris Lattner | Remove extraneous return value from insertValue and... |
tree | commitdiff |
2007-01-09 |
Reid Spencer | For PR1099: |
tree | commitdiff |
2007-01-08 |
Evan Cheng | Naming consistency. |
tree | commitdiff |
2007-01-08 |
Evan Cheng | Fix for PR1075: bottom-up register-reduction scheduling... |
tree | commitdiff |
2007-01-08 |
Chris Lattner | Implement some trivial FP foldings when -enable-unsafe... |
tree | commitdiff |
2007-01-08 |
Jim Laskey | Need to handle static declarations properly. |
tree | commitdiff |
2007-01-08 |
Jeff Cohen | Unbreak VC++ build. |
tree | commitdiff |
2007-01-08 |
Reid Spencer | Parameter attributes are part of a FunctionType and... |
tree | commitdiff |
2007-01-08 |
Devang Patel | Add PMStack, a Pass Manager stack. |
tree | commitdiff |
2007-01-08 |
Andrew Lenharth | And asm writing for packed struct initializers |
tree | commitdiff |
2007-01-08 |
Andrew Lenharth | Make packed structs use packed initialiers for consistency |
tree | commitdiff |
2007-01-08 |
Reid Spencer | Comparison of primitive type sizes should now be done... |
tree | commitdiff |
2007-01-08 |
Reid Spencer | For PR1097: |
tree | commitdiff |
2007-01-08 |
Reid Spencer | For PR1090: |
tree | commitdiff |
2007-01-08 |
Reid Spencer | Fix PR1090: |
tree | commitdiff |
2007-01-08 |
Reid Spencer | Fix a bug in an assert that would never trigger. |
tree | commitdiff |
2007-01-08 |
Reid Spencer | Convert uses of getPrimitiveSize that should be getPrim... |
tree | commitdiff |
2007-01-07 |
Reid Spencer | Types should be const. |
tree | commitdiff |
2007-01-07 |
Chris Lattner | this pass is unused |
tree | commitdiff |
2007-01-07 |
Chris Lattner | llvm 2.0 doesn't support llvm.isunordered.* |
tree | commitdiff |
2007-01-07 |
Chris Lattner | remove support for llvm.isunordered |
tree | commitdiff |
2007-01-07 |
Chris Lattner | remove llvm.isunordered |
tree | commitdiff |
2007-01-07 |
Chris Lattner | Change the interface to Module::getOrInsertFunction... |
tree | commitdiff |
2007-01-07 |
Chris Lattner | Change the interface to Module::getOrInsertFunction... |
tree | commitdiff |
2007-01-07 |
Chris Lattner | prepare for adjustment to getOrInsertFunction method |
tree | commitdiff |
2007-01-07 |
Chris Lattner | relax type |
tree | commitdiff |
2007-01-07 |
Chris Lattner | relax some types |
tree | commitdiff |
2007-01-07 |
Chris Lattner | relax types |
tree | commitdiff |
2007-01-07 |
Chris Lattner | relax some types |
tree | commitdiff |
2007-01-07 |
Chris Lattner | remove support for old-style varargs upgrading |
tree | commitdiff |
2007-01-07 |
Reid Spencer | For PR1086: |
tree | commitdiff |
2007-01-07 |
Chris Lattner | Fix PR1015 and Transforms/IndVarsSimplify/2007-01-06... |
tree | commitdiff |
2007-01-07 |
Chris Lattner | cast of int to bool no longer does a compare, rendering... |
tree | commitdiff |
2007-01-07 |
Chris Lattner | add -debug output for -indvars. |
tree | commitdiff |
2007-01-07 |
Anton Korobeynikov | As PR1085 was fixed, back out workaround |
tree | commitdiff |
2007-01-06 |
Chris Lattner | wow, the link was already broken :) |
tree | commitdiff |
2007-01-06 |
Chris Lattner | add a note |
tree | commitdiff |
2007-01-06 |
Chris Lattner | Disable the macho writer until it is 100% functional... |
tree | commitdiff |
2007-01-06 |
Chris Lattner | Fix regressions in InstCombine/call-cast-target.ll... |
tree | commitdiff |
2007-01-06 |
Anton Korobeynikov | gcc often inserts it's own names for sections (e.g. |
tree | commitdiff |
2007-01-06 |
Reid Spencer | For PR411: |
tree | commitdiff |
2007-01-06 |
Chris Lattner | this final call to canLosslesslyBitCastTo is dead,... |
tree | commitdiff |
2007-01-06 |
Chris Lattner | simplify some more code now that there are not multiple... |
tree | commitdiff |
2007-01-06 |
Chris Lattner | eliminate some uses of canLosslesslyBitCastTo, this... |
tree | commitdiff |
2007-01-06 |
Chris Lattner | no need to worry about int vs uint any more. |
tree | commitdiff |
2007-01-06 |
Chris Lattner | new note |
tree | commitdiff |
2007-01-05 |
Evan Cheng | setSetCCIsExpensive is gone. |
tree | commitdiff |
2007-01-05 |
Evan Cheng | Expand fcopysign to the bitwise sequence if select... |
tree | commitdiff |
2007-01-05 |
Devang Patel | 1) Remove old AnalysisResolver. |
tree | commitdiff |
2007-01-05 |
Reid Spencer | Regenerate. |
tree | commitdiff |
2007-01-05 |
Reid Spencer | For PR1077: |
tree | commitdiff |
2007-01-05 |
Evan Cheng | - FCOPYSIGN custom lowering bug. Clear the sign bit... |
tree | commitdiff |
2007-01-05 |
Evan Cheng | Bug in ExpandFCOPYSIGNToBitwiseOps(). Clear the old... |
tree | commitdiff |
2007-01-05 |
Evan Cheng | CopyToReg source operand can be a register as well... |
tree | commitdiff |
2007-01-05 |
Devang Patel | Remove PassManagerT.h |
tree | commitdiff |
2007-01-05 |
Devang Patel | Remove old pass manager. |
tree | commitdiff |
2007-01-05 |
Reid Spencer | Regenerate. |
tree | commitdiff |
2007-01-05 |
Reid Spencer | Change the syntax for parameter attributes: |
tree | commitdiff |
2007-01-05 |
Evan Cheng | Typo |
tree | commitdiff |
2007-01-05 |
Evan Cheng | With SSE2, expand FCOPYSIGN to a series of SSE bitwise... |
tree | commitdiff |
2007-01-05 |
Chris Lattner | Implement InstCombine/vec_shuffle.ll:%test7, simplifyin... |
tree | commitdiff |
2007-01-05 |
Chris Lattner | fold things like a^b != c^a -> b != c. This implements... |
tree | commitdiff |
2007-01-05 |
Chris Lattner | Compile X + ~X to -1. This implements Instcombine... |
tree | commitdiff |
2007-01-05 |
Evan Cheng | GEP subscript is interpreted as a signed value. |
tree | commitdiff |
2007-01-04 |
Chris Lattner | fix PowerPC/2007-01-04-ArgExtension.ll, a bug handling... |
tree | commitdiff |
2007-01-04 |
Evan Cheng | Expand fcopysign to a series of bitwise of operations... |
tree | commitdiff |
2007-01-04 |
Lauro Ramos Venancio | Expand SELECT (f32/f64) and FCOPYSIGN (f32/f64). |
tree | commitdiff |
2007-01-04 |
Reid Spencer | Death to useless bitcast instructions! |
tree | commitdiff |
2007-01-04 |
Reid Spencer | Do not allow packed types for icmp and fcmp instructions. |
tree | commitdiff |
2007-01-04 |
Reid Spencer | Regenerate. |
tree | commitdiff |
2007-01-04 |
Reid Spencer | Disallow packed types in icmp/fcmp instructions. The... |
tree | commitdiff |
2007-01-04 |
Chris Lattner | Now that setcondinst has been eliminated, we can mark... |
tree | commitdiff |
2007-01-04 |
Chris Lattner | fix typo |
tree | commitdiff |
2007-01-04 |
Chris Lattner | Enable a couple xforms for packed vectors (undef |... |
tree | commitdiff |
next |